Как правильно переслать таблицу Excel по электронной почте: все способы с примерами

Отправка таблиц Microsoft Excel через электронную почту кажется простой задачей — пока не сталкиваешься с проблемами. То файл не влез в ограничение по размеру, то получатель видит вместо данных «кракозябры», то формулы suddenly перестают работать. А если нужно отправить не просто таблицу, а отчёт с диаграммами, сводными таблицами и условным форматированием — риски искажения данных вырастают в разы.

В этой статье разберём все актуальные способы отправки Excel-файлов по email — от классического вложения до продвинутых методов с облачными сервисами. Вы узнаете, как подготовить файл к отправке, чтобы сохранить структуру данных, избежать ошибок совместимости и даже отслеживать изменения после отправки. А ещё — почему никогда не стоит отправлять Excel через «Копировать-Вставить» напрямую в тело письма (спойлер: это ломает 90% формул).

1. Классический способ: отправка Excel как вложение

Самый очевидный метод — прикрепить файл .xlsx или .xls к письму. Он работает в 99% случаев, но имеет нюансы, о которых многие забывают.

Во-первых, проверьте ограничения вашего почтового сервиса. Например, Gmail блокирует вложения больше 25 МБ, а Mail.ru — 30 МБ. Если ваш файл тяжелее, почта либо откажется его отправлять, либо сожмёт автоматически (что может повредить данные). Во-вторых, некоторые корпоративные почтовые системы (например, Microsoft Exchange) по умолчанию блокируют файлы с макросами (.xlsm) из соображений безопасности.

  • 📎 Плюсы: простота, не требует дополнительных сервисов, сохраняет все формулы и форматирование.
  • ⚠️ Минусы: ограничения по размеру, риск блокировки антивирусом, возможные проблемы с совместимостью версий Excel.
  • 🔄 Когда использовать: для небольших файлов (до 20 МБ) и внутренней переписки внутри одной организации.

Чтобы отправить файл как вложение:

  1. Откройте ваш почтовый клиент (например, Outlook или веб-версию Gmail).
  2. Создайте новое письмо и нажмите кнопку «Вложить файл» (обычно обозначается скрепкой 📎).
  3. Выберите Excel-файл на вашем компьютере. Если нужно отправить несколько таблиц — заархивируйте их в .zip.
  4. Заполните тему и текст письма, укажите получателя и отправьте.

Проверьте размер файла (не более 20 МБ)

Убедитесь, что в имени файла нет символов !@#$%^&*

Сохраните файл в формате .xlsx (не .xls, если не уверены в версии Excel у получателя)

Отключите защиту листа, если она не нужна получателю-->

⚠️ Внимание: Если вы отправляете файл с макросами (.xlsm), предупредите получателя заранее. Многие почтовые серверы и антивирусы автоматически удаляют макросы из вложений или помечают такие письма как «подозрительные».

2. Экспорт Excel в PDF: когда нужно гарантировать неизменность данных

Если ваша задача — передать данные так, чтобы их нельзя было изменить (например, финансовый отчёт или коммерческое предложение), лучший вариант — конвертировать Excel в .pdf. Этот формат сохраняет всё форматирование, но блокирует редактирование.

Преимущество PDF в том, что он открывается на любом устройстве без искажений, тогда как Excel может отображаться по-разному в зависимости от версии программы или операционной системы. Например, шрифт Calibri, который используется по умолчанию в Excel, может не отобразиться на MacOS, если у получателя его нет в системе — а PDF этого избегает.

  • 📄 Как сохранить Excel в PDF:
    1. Откройте ваш файл в Excel.
    2. Перейдите в Файл → Экспорт → Создать PDF/XPS.
    3. Выберите папку для сохранения и нажмите «Опубликовать».
  • 🔍 На что обратить внимание: Перед экспортом проверьте Параметры страницы (Разметка → Поля → Показать поля), чтобы таблица не обрезалась при печати.
  • Формат Сохраняет формулы Можно редактировать Совместимость Размер файла
    .xlsx Да Да Требует Excel или аналоги (LibreOffice, Google Sheets) Средний
    .pdf Нет (отображает значения) Нет Любое устройство Меньше, чем .xlsx
    .csv Нет Да (но без форматирования) Любой табличный редактор Минимальный

    Excel (.xlsx)

    PDF

    CSV

    Google Sheets (ссылка)

    Другой-->

    Если вам нужно, чтобы получатель видел и данные, и формулы, но не мог их изменить, используйте защиту листа в Excel:

    1. Выделите все ячейки (Ctrl + A).
    2. Перейдите в Главная → Формат → Защитить лист.
    3. Установите пароль (необязательно) и нажмите «OK».
    4. Сохраните файл и отправьте как обычно.

    3. Облачные сервисы: Google Sheets, OneDrive и Dropbox

    Если файл слишком большой (более 30 МБ) или вы хотите отслеживать изменения после отправки, используйте облачные сервисы. Они позволяют:

    • 🔗 Отправлять ссылку вместо файла (экономит место в почте).
    • 🔄 Настраивать доступ (только просмотр, комментирование или редактирование).
    • 📊 Видеть историю изменений (кто и когда правил данные).

    Рассмотрим три популярных варианта:

    3.1. Google Sheets (Google Таблицы)

    Идеален для совместной работы. Вы загружаете Excel-файл в Google Drive, конвертируете его в Google Sheets и делитесь ссылкой. Преимущество — автоматическое сохранение и возможность одновременного редактирования несколькими пользователями.

    Как отправить:

    1. Перейдите на sheets.google.com.
    2. Нажмите «Пусто» или «Импорт файла» → выберите ваш .xlsx.
    3. После загрузки нажмите «Поделиться» (кнопка в правом верхнем углу).
    4. Скопируйте ссылку и вставьте её в письмо.

    3.2. Microsoft OneDrive

    Лучший выбор, если вы и получатель используете Office 365. Файл открывается прямо в браузере в полноценном Excel Online без потерь форматирования.

    Инструкция:

    1. Загрузите файл на OneDrive.
    2. Кликните правой кнопкой по файлу → «Поделиться».
    3. Выберите «Любой, у кого есть ссылка» и настройте права (просмотр/редактирование).
    4. Скопируйте ссылку и отправьте по email.

    3.3. Dropbox

    Удобен для отправки крупных файлов (до 2 ГБ в бесплатной версии). Подходит, если получатель не использует Google или Microsoft.

    Особенность: можно настроить срок действия ссылки (например, 7 дней), после которого доступ закроется автоматически.

    Как ограничить доступ к файлу в Dropbox?

    В настройках ссылки выберите «Люди с паролем» или «Только люди, приглашённые по email». Также можно установить дату истечения ссылки в разделе «Настройки ссылки» → «Дата окончания».

    ⚠️ Внимание: Если вы отправляете ссылку на облачный файл, всегда проверяйте права доступа. По умолчанию многие сервисы (например, Google Sheets) дают право на редактирование, что может привести к случайному изменению данных. Лучше выставляйте «Только просмотр», если не нужна совместная работа.

    4. Альтернативные форматы: CSV, XML и другие

    Иногда стандартные .xlsx или .pdf не подходят. Например, если получатель работает с базой данных или специализированным ПО, может потребоваться .csv или .xml.

    CSV (Comma-Separated Values) — это «сырые» данные без форматирования, которые открываются в любом табличном редакторе. Подходит для передачи больших массивов данных (например, прайс-листов или логов). Однако в CSV теряются:

    • 📉 Формулы (сохраняются только значения).
    • 🎨 Цвета, шрифты, объединённые ячейки.
    • 📊 Диаграммы и сводные таблицы.

    Как сохранить Excel в CSV:

    1. Откройте файл в Excel.
    2. Перейдите в Файл → Сохранить как.
    3. В поле «Тип файла» выберите CSV (разделители — запятые).
    4. Сохраните и отправьте полученный файл.

    XML используется реже, но может пригодиться для интеграции с другими системами (например, 1С или CRM). Чтобы экспортировать в XML:

    1. В Excel перейдите в Файл → Сохранить как.
    2. Выберите XML-данные (*.xml).
    3. Подтвердите экспорт (Excel может запросить схему XML — если не знаете, что это, выберите «Без схемы»).

    5. Продвинутые методы: сжатие, разбивка и шифрование

    Если файл слишком большой или содержит конфиденциальную информацию, обычной отправкой не обойтись. Вот что можно сделать:

    5.1. Архивация (ZIP/RAR)

    Сжатие файла в .zip или .rar решает две проблемы:

    • 📦 Уменьшает размер (иногда в 2–3 раза).
    • 🔒 Позволяет установить пароль на архив.

    Как заархивировать:

    1. Кликните правой кнопкой по файлу Excel.
    2. Выберите «Сжать» (на MacOS) или «Добавить в архив» (на Windows через WinRAR или 7-Zip).
    3. Если нужно, установите пароль в настройках архивации.
    4. Отправьте полученный .zip по email.

    5.2. Разбивка на части

    Если файл весит сотни мегабайт, разбейте его на несколько листов или книг. Например:

    • 📂 Разделите данные по месяцам/отделам.
    • 📑 Сохраните каждый лист как отдельный файл (Файл → Сохранить как → Выбрать листы).
    • 📧 Отправьте несколько писем или загрузите части в облако.

    5.3. Шифрование

    Для конфиденциальных данных (например, зарплатные ведомости) используйте шифрование:

    • 🔐 В Excel: Файл → Сведения → Защитить книгу → Зашифровать паролем.
    • 🔐 В архиве: установите пароль при сжатии (например, в 7-Zip или WinRAR).
    ⚠️ Внимание: Если вы шифруете файл паролем, отправляйте пароль отдельно (например, в SMS или мессенджере). Никогда не указывайте его в том же письме — это сводит на нет всю защиту!

    6. Распространённые ошибки и как их избежать

    Даже опытные пользователи иногда допускают ошибки при отправке Excel по email. Вот самые частые из них:

    • 🚫 Отправка без проверки формул: Если в таблице есть ссылки на другие файлы (например, =VLOOKUP([Другой_файл.xlsx]Лист1!A1)), они сломаются у получателя. Всегда используйте Абсолютные ссылки или проверяйте зависимости (Формулы → Зависимости формул).
    • 🚫 Игнорирование версий Excel: Файл, сохранённый в Excel 2019, может не открыться в Excel 2003. Используйте формат .xlsx (а не .xls) для максимальной совместимости.
    • 🚫 Копирование данных в тело письма: Если вы вручную копируете таблицу и вставляете в email, формулы превратятся в статичные значения, а форматирование слетит. Вместо этого экспортируйте в PDF или отправляйте оригинальный файл.

    Ещё одна типичная проблема — искажение кодировки (вместо кириллицы отображаются «кракозябры»). Это происходит, если:

    • Файл сохранён в неправильной кодировке (например, ANSI вместо UTF-8).
    • Получатель открывает CSV-файл в блокноте, а не в Excel.

    Как избежать:

    1. При сохранении в CSV выбирайте UTF-8 (в Excel: Файл → Сохранить как → Инструменты → Параметры веб-страницы → Кодировка: UTF-8).
    2. Предупредите получателя, что файл нужно открывать в Excel, а не в текстовом редакторе.

    7. Как проверить, что получатель увидит то же, что и вы

    Перед отправкой всегда тестируйте, как файл будет выглядеть у получателя. Вот как это сделать:

    1. Отправьте тестовое письмо себе: Проверьте вложение на другом устройстве или в веб-версии почты.
    2. Используйте «Режим проверки»: В Excel перейдите в Файл → Сведения → Проверка на наличие проблем → Проверка совместимости. Это покажет, какие функции могут не работать в старых версиях.
    3. Просмотрите в «Безопасном режиме»: Откройте файл в Excel с зажатой клавишей Ctrl (это отключает надстройки и макросы, имитируя открытие на чужом ПК).

    Если вы отправляете файл через облако (Google Sheets, OneDrive), проверьте права доступа:

    • Откройте ссылку в режиме инкогнито браузера.
    • Убедитесь, что не требуется авторизация (если не предполагается).
    • Попробуйте отредактировать данные — если не нужно, ограничьте права.

    FAQ: Ответы на частые вопросы

    Можно ли отправить Excel-файл через WhatsApp или Telegram?

    Да, но с оговорками:

    • 📱 WhatsApp ограничивает размер файла 100 МБ (2 ГБ в некоторых регионах).
    • 📊 Telegram позволяет отправлять файлы до 2 ГБ, но они сжимаются, если превышают 20 МБ.
    • ⚠️ В обоих мессенджерах файлы могут открываться с искажениями (особенно если используются редкие шрифты или сложные формулы).

    Для важных документов лучше использовать email или облачные сервисы.

    Почему получатель видит в файле знаки вопроса вместо букв?

    Это проблема кодировки. Чаще всего она возникает при:

    • Сохранении CSV-файла в ANSI вместо UTF-8.
    • Открытии CSV в блокноте (нужно использовать Excel или LibreOffice).
    • Использовании нестандартных шрифтов в Excel (например, Wingdings).

    Решение: сохраните файл в UTF-8 или отправьте оригинальный .xlsx.

    Как отправить Excel так, чтобы получатель не мог изменить данные?

    Есть несколько способов:

    1. Сохраните в PDF (данные будут только для просмотра).
    2. Защитите лист в Excel: Рецензирование → Защитить лист.
    3. Отправьте как картинку: сделайте скриншот таблицы (PrtScn) и вставьте в письмо.
    4. Используйте облако с правами «Только просмотр» (Google Sheets, OneDrive).

    Самый надёжный вариант — PDF, так как его нельзя редактировать без специальных программ.

    Что делать, если почта не отправляет файл из-за вируса?

    Некоторые почтовые серверы (например, корпоративные) блокируют файлы с макросами (.xlsm) или подозрительными формулами. Решения:

    • 📧 Переименуйте расширение на .xlsx (если макросы не нужны).
    • 🔐 Заархивируйте файл с паролем и отправьте архив.
    • ☁️ Загрузите файл в облако (Google Drive, OneDrive) и отправьте ссылку.
    • 📄 Сохраните данные в PDF или CSV (без макросов).

    Если проблема повторяется, свяжитесь с администратором почтового сервера — возможно, на стороне получателя стоят жёсткие ограничения.

    Можно ли отправить Excel так, чтобы получатель увидел только часть данных?

    Да, для этого:

    1. Скройте листы или строки/столбцы:
      • Выделите ячейки → правая кнопка → «Скрыть».
      • Чтобы разблокировать, нужно будет вручную выбрать Главная → Формат → Скрыть/отобразить.
  • Используйте фильтры:
    • Примените автофильтр (Данные → Фильтр) и оставьте только нужные строки.
    • Сохраните файл и отправьте — получатель увидит только отфильтрованные данные (но сможет снять фильтр).
    • Создайте отдельный файл с нужными данными (самый надёжный способ).

    Для полной уверенности отправляйте два файла: полный (запароленный) и урезанный (для просмотра).